[5ALTY] But_Can_You_Meme Players 157 posts 11,622 battles Report post #2 Posted October 9, 2020 I have the same issue. To get the sound to return on the first squadron, launch them, once they're taking off press M and go to the map. Press M again and when you return to the squad, their sounds are back.
